Description

A STUNNING AND SPACIOUS EXTENDED FOUR DOUBLE BEDROOM DETACHED family home, RESTING ON A GENEROUS PLOT and situated on the prestigious NON ESTATE location of Whalley Drive. It is located within walking distance to Bletchley train station providing mainline links to London Euston within 45 minutes, as well as easy access to the A5 and M1. In addition the town centre and MK1 Shopping Centre are also a fairly short distance with all the amenities they have to offer including shops, leisure and schools. The accommodation in brief comprises entrance hall, downstairs cloakroom, lounge with feature fireplace, dining room, HIGH QUALITY MODERN KITCHEN WITH QUARTZ WORKSURFACES and integrated appliances, UTILITY ROOM, GARDEN ROOM, first floor landing, FOUR GOOD SIZE BEDROOMS and a QUALITY REFITTED SHOWER ROOM. The benefits include UPVC double glazing, gas to radiator central heating, GENEROUS AND BEAUTIFULLY MAINTED REAR GARDEN, part garage that can be used for storage and a driveway to the front offering off road parking for up to four vehicles. The current vendors have made many improvements over recent years, all to a very high standard and as such INTERNAL VIEWING COMES WITH OUR HIGHEST RECOMMENDATION to fully appreciate. EPC rating D.
